Tough day ahead


First court date today to divorce my AH. He will only go for half my retirement, he says, and he will not ask me for alimony as long as I don't ask him for any child support. Wow. He hasn't worked in well over a year because of drinking and pain pills...I'm struggling to keep oil in the tank and food on the table..he continues to blame me for his lousy lot in life.

Nasty separation (1 year ago), bankruptcy, and now divorce..and I'm trying so hard to keep it together at work -- so many demands, and a coworker who loves to point out the 1 or 2 things that I have missed (despite having done 200 things right)...so hard to concentrate...

I'm feeling scared, alone, and sick of being on the wrong end of the stick. Need some support and validation that i'm not a loser.

Hugs Rehprof,

Easy does it be gentle on yourself. I hope you are doing something to take care of you. Something I have found that works wonders for me is doing a quick gratitude list when things feel the darkest in the day, 5 things to think of when things don't feel like they are the greatest.

Sending love and support, no one on this board is a looser,

Hugs P :)

PS - I also wanted to point out what would you say to your bff if they called you telling they felt this way and what was going on with them?  Sometimes it's best to take a look at the situation and say gee, why am I being so hard on myself.  I would never tell someone else that.
